Question
the triangles are similar.
what is the value of x?
5
16
4
\frac{1}{16}
Step1: Identify corresponding sides
Since the triangles are similar, the ratios of corresponding sides are equal. The hypotenuse of the first triangle is 20, and the hypotenuse of the second is 5. The vertical side of the second triangle is 4, and the vertical side of the first is \( x \).
Step2: Set up the proportion
The ratio of hypotenuses is \( \frac{20}{5} \), and the ratio of vertical sides is \( \frac{x}{4} \). Since they are equal:
$$
\frac{20}{5} = \frac{x}{4}
$$
Step3: Solve for \( x \)
Simplify \( \frac{20}{5} = 4 \), so:
$$
4 = \frac{x}{4}
$$
Multiply both sides by 4:
$$
x = 4 \times 4 = 16
$$
